Staff Recommendation
Staff approved a Certificate of Appropriates for a sign permit, with the following waivers, on July 22nd, 2025.

1) Waiver from Design Guideline 4.1.5 to permit a semi-gloss finish.
2) Waiver from Design Guideline 4.4.3 to permit a second building sign.
The applicant is requesting two new building signs: one externally illuminated 100 sq ft sign that will be placed on the south side of the building, facing I-40/I-75, and one non-illuminated 64 sq ft sign on the east side of the building, oriented towards Lexington Drive.

PURSUANT TO ARTICLE V, SECTION 4 OF THE TTCDA ADMINISTRATIVE RULES AND PROCEDURES, THE DECISION OF THE TTCDA TO APPROVE A SIGN MUST BE BASED ON THE FOLLOWING CRITERIA:

A. CONFORMITY OF THE SIGN PROPOSAL WITH THE DESIGN GUIDELINES.
1. The subject site is situated in the rear of an industrial park that is accessed by a private right-of-way from Lexington Drive. A waiver from Design Guideline 4.4.3 to permit a second building sign on the east side of the building has been approved in order to allow adequate wayfinding signage for the building. The second building sign is not anticipated to detract from the overall signage system.
2. Both signs will have the same design and color scheme. The signage will feature the company name, parent company, and logo in three colors: yellow, white, and black. They will be placed below the height of the building on the south and east sides.
3. The south side of the building has a frontage of 186 ft, and the east side has a length 138 ft. The maximum allowable square footage per sign is 100 sq ft. The proposed signs are within the maximum allowable square footage.
4. The applicant requested a waiver from Design Guideline 4.1.5, requiring sign finishes to be matte or flat to allow a semi-gloss finish due to the Caterpillar corporate brand standards. The waiver has been approved, as it is not anticipated to detract from the overall signage system.
5. The externally illuminated sign will be illuminated with tetra lighting placed above the sign. The sign will consist of a polycarbonate cabinet with aluminum backing directly mounted to the building façade.
6. The nonilluminated sign will consist of a flat-cut aluminum panel that is directly mounted on the building façade.

B. RELATIONSHIP OF THE PROPOSED SIGNAGE TO SIGNAGE ON NEARBY PROPERTIES, IN TERMS OF SIZE, LOCATION, MATERIALS, AND COLOR.
1. The proposed signs are in proportion with the signs in the vicinity.
